Crime overview

Rosevine Way area has the 23rd lowest crime rate of 51 local areas in Camborne Roskear & Tuckingmill , and the 786th highest crime rate of 1,819 local areas in Cornwall .

At least one of the neighbouring streets has high or very high crime levels. However, overall crime around this postcode is more mixed, with some nearby areas experiencing lower crime.

The overall crime rate in the area around Rosevine Way (TR14 0DY) in the last 12 months was 55.6 per 1,000 residents and was 42.1% lower than the Camborne Roskear & Tuckingmill average (96.1 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 24 offences recorded. The least common crime was Burglary with 1 case , unchanged from 2025. The fastest-growing crime category was Drugs ( 100.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Other theft ( -50.0% YoY).

Violent crimes totalled 24 (≈ 35.1 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were falling ( -17.2%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-7.5% comparing early vs recent averages) .

In the area around Rosevine Way (TR14 0DY), the main crime hotspot is near Gwarder Place. Police recorded 14 crimes here, including 12 violent or public-order offences. All these locations are within roughly 0.3 miles.
